Basic Information about BSK-Seminars
- In the Seminar-Calendar you can find a synopsis of all BSK seminars for the actual year.
- All BSK-Seminars take place Saturday 11 a.m. – 1 p.m. (seminar-topic), 2 p.m. – 4 p.m. (seminar-topic), 4 p.m. – 5 p.m. (Bojutsu / participation mandatory) and Sunday 10 a.m. – 1 p.m. (seminar-topic).
- Participants of the seminars are invited (mandatory) to arrive on Friday evening. On Friday between 8 and 10 p.m. an introduction to the topic of the weekend seminar will be given. (except: Kobudo, Taijiquan, Qigong).
- The Friday training is an addition to the seminars that is free of charge. It is a useful opportunity for a first contact between participants and BSK teachers.
- It is possible to stay overnight in the Budokan with a sleeping-bag. But this includes cleaning of the Dojo and the connected rooms. It is also possible to bring your own food (the Budokan has a kitchen with all necessary facilities).
- You can find a road description to the Budokan in the seminar-description itself. If you decide not to spend the night at the Budokan, you can find information about accommodation and other facilities in Bensheim.
Rules for participation
The BSK is just accepting participants who provide a binding application. By declaring to participate the applicant is accepting the rules written below.
- Generally BSK-seminars in the Budokan provide a maximum of 25 places. These places are very popular and a lot of seminars are booked out weeks before.
- Therefore applicants are requested to fill in the application-form for the seminars including name, address, grade and organization OBLIGATORILY.
- Without complete adress the application form will not be accepted.
- Applications and registrations will be accepted in their order of arrival.

Rules for visitors of the Budokan
Visitors of BSK-seminars should be aware of the following rules.
- Our visitors are requested to adapt to the community of the BSK/Budokan and to respect the BSK-rules for the time of their stay. Rules of other organizations are not valid in the BSK.
- Since we make it possible to stay overnight, we expect participants to take part in cleaning the Budokan.
